Age 82, of Clio, passed away Sunday, February 5, 2023, at home with his family by his side. In accordance with Donald’s wishes, cremation has taken place. There are no further services scheduled at this time. Expressions of sympathy may be placed on Donald’s tribute wall at martinfuneralhome.com.

 

Donald was born in Flint on March 2, 1940, the son of Mr. and Mrs. James and Francis (Raden) Unsel. Donald met and married Julie Hyde, on September 14, 1999. Donald worked on the Assembly Line for GM-Buick for 30 years, until his retirement in 2002. He was a long-time member of UAW Local #599. At the age of just two years old, Donald moved into his grandparents’ home, where he was loved and cared for by them his entire life. Tinkering on cars was his passion. He could modify and fix anything on any old car, with small engine repair being his specialty. Donald loved to go fishing on the Great Lakes as well as the Saginaw Bay with his best friend. He also enjoyed bird hunting. He was a skilled marksman and could shoot anything out of the air. In his free time, Donald enjoyed shooting pool and playing cards. He had a tremendous love for all animals, but his dogs, Boomer and Carly, were like his children. He would cook them dinner on a regular basis. Donald was a very friendly man and would do anything to help others. Donald enjoyed spending time with his family and had a very close relationship with his children and stepchildren. He saw no difference in any of them, they were all his own. He also loved his grandchildren and will be greatly missed by all who knew him.  

 
Left to cherish Donald's memory are his wife, Julie Unsel; children: Dawn Unsel (Jackie Buckley), Andrea Unsel, and Nancy Penney, Aaron, and wife, Tonnie Unsel, Melissa Unsel, Ronald Swank; step-children: Anthony Gates, Dennis Gates, and Tina and husband, Richard Waters; 18 grandchildren; many great-grandchildren; brother, J.W. "Dud" Unsel; sister, Carol, and many other family members and friends. 

 

Donald was preceded in death by his parents; brothers: Arvil and Thomas; sisters: Nadine, Lucille, Verna, and Mary Joyce.
